UncutApr 17, 2013An engagingly simple and yet sophisticated third album, full of elegant melodies, shuffling percussion and bewitching Marling-esque vocals. [May 2013, p.67]
-
Apr 29, 2013Here on The Still Life she has begun to solidify and challenge her undoubted songwriting ability.
-
Apr 17, 2013In total, The Still Life is a spry and rewarding sonic balm that doesn’t outstay its welcome.
-
Apr 17, 2013It’s definitely a progression from her last album into a more profound and polished sound.
-
Apr 17, 2013While there is nothing astounding or extraordinary about The Still Life, what it does is indicate that Alessi Laurent-Marke is a songwriter and musician who already shows a real promise of creating something very special later on in her career.
-
Q MagazineApr 17, 2013One to bask in. [May 2013, p.94]
-
MojoApr 17, 2013Laurent-Marke's facility for pleasant minor-key ruminations remain her strong suit, but the "stillness" of which she speaks all too often sounds like a stifling lack of urgency. [May 2013, p.85]
